| catalytic Activity | CATALYTIC ACTIVITY: Reaction=Release of an unsubstituted, C-terminal glutamyl residue, typically from Ac-Asp-Glu or folylpoly-gamma-glutamates.; EC=3.4.17.21; Evidence={ECO:0000305}; |
| DNA Binding | |
| EC Number | 3.4.17.21 |
| Enzyme Function | FUNCTION: Acts in association with AMP1 to suppress ectopic stem cell niche formation in the shoot apical meristem (SAM) independently of cytokinin signaling pathway. {ECO:0000269|PubMed:25673776}. |
